Charitable & Community work

Each year , the pupils of the school assist a number of charities. The include Concern, GOAL, Childline, IHCPT (Childrens' Pilgrimage to Lourdes).
Pupils donate a portion of their First Communion and Confirmation money to a designated charity.

The pupils also assist the local Tidy Towns committee by taking part in an annual litter clean up of the town.

Our school choir visits local old folks homes and hospitals to sing for the residents/patients .
